Among the most intriguing trends in the food sector is experience-based dining. As customers come to be more interested in unique dining experiences, many restaurants are looking towards embracing the idea of experiential dining to differentiate themselves from other businesses in an exceedingly demanding market. This industry trend appears to extend beyond just food quality, with substantial emphasis on setting and storytelling to produce an interactive and memorable dining experience. Examples of these services can include themed environments, interactive meal preparation or theatrical aspects, through use of lighting and performance entertainment from in house personnel. The objective of experiential dining is to immerse all the senses and create an emotionally engaging time, in addition to supplying excellent food. This evolution reflects a broader cultural shift in customer interests, towards valuing experiences over material goods, strongly affecting how restaurants craft and provide food related services.

The ongoing integration of technology into restaurant affairs has transformed many industry processes in the food sector. With the acceleration of digital developments, restaurants are increasing the use of new technological advancements. Tools such as mobile ordering platforms and contactless payments are helping to improve internal activities along with reshaping the dining experience to suit the requirements of modern-day customers. These innovations have also allowed for the advancement of new, non-traditional restaurant services, which includes ghost kitchens. This shift in the food service niche is mainly driven by the development of food delivery services. These facilities operate without a conventional dining area, allowing providers to concentrate more on quality. As this design has low overheads, establishments can invest more into overall performance, such as restaurant kitchen equipment and higher quality produce. Over the last few years, sustainability has prevailed and as an important lead in the international food sector. Extensively check here driven by an increase in environmental awareness, restaurants are increasingly beginning to embrace ways to reduce their carbon footprint, prompting a shift towards more greener operations. Just recently, consumer trends in restaurant industry activities are laying additional demands for more ethical practices. Initiatives are concentrating on reducing food waste and adopting more environment-friendly packaging solutions to decrease environmental impacts. Furthermore, by supporting regional producers, food facilities are encouraging more conscious sourcing. This drive towards sustainability is not only morally fulfilling, but also a tactical reaction to evolving market expectations.
